Anuradhapura: there are better ways than bombs, surely?














Moonstone at the entrance to one of the monks' seminaries in ancient Anuradhapura. (Photo by Susi.)
At least 61 people have been killed after a civilian bus was struck by a mine in northern Sri Lanka, police say. Another 45 people were wounded in the explosion in Anuradhapura district, 200km (125 miles) north of Colombo. Full story at the BBC web site.
